Near FM has over 30 years experience in outside broadcasts in Dublin city and its suburbs. The Near FM Outside Broadcast package includes:

  • set up inside your venue or outside with our gazebo, desk and microphones.
  • 6 pre-recorded promos prior to the broadcast
  • 3 live mentions per hour of a pre agreed tag line.

Near FM Outside broadcasts vary from recordings of ‘Sunday at Noon’ concerts in the Hugh Lane Gallery, Woodquay Summer Sessions in the amphitheatre at Wood Quay to festivals from St Anne’s Park, Culture Night Live, open days in community centres and schools, discussions in Trinity College Dublin, debates in libraries and cultural centres.
